|
Summary of Significant Accounting Policies - Additional Information (Detail)
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2012
Clients
|
Jun. 30, 2012
Clients
|
Sep. 30, 2011
Clients
|Revenue Recognition, Multiple-deliverable Arrangements [Line Items]
|Number of clients accounted for 10% or more of total revenue
|0
|0
|Percentage of revenue accounted by major clients
|10.00%
|10.00%
|Percentage of net accounts receivable from major clients
|10.00%
|10.00%
|Number of clients accounted for 10% or more of net accounts receivable
|0
|0
|U.S municipal securities and certificates of deposits maturity period
|90 days
|X
|
- Definition
Maximum percentage of net accounts receivable accounted by client.
No definition available.
|X
|
- Definition
Maximum Percentage Of Revenue Represented By Any Customer
No definition available.
|X
|
- Definition
Money market instruments maturity period.
No definition available.
|X
|
- Definition
Number Of Customers Accounted For More Than Ten Percent Of Accounts Receivable
No definition available.
|X
|
- Definition
Number Of Customers Representing Greater Than Ten Percent Of Net Sales Or Accounts Receivable
No definition available.
|X
|
- Details